Muay Thai Mastery and Octagon Trajectory
Chidi Njokuani’s career has long been defined by sharp, violent finishes and elite range control. Utilizing a long frame with an exceptional reach advantage across the middleweight and light heavyweight divisions, Njokuani relies on sniper-like straight punches, push kicks, and brutal collar-tie elbows to dismantle opponents who attempt to close the distance.
When breakdown specialists analyze a Njokuani matchup, the opening two minutes of the first round command the most focus. His ability to dictate range immediately forces pressure fighters and wrestlers into panicked entries. These ill-advised shoots often run directly into intercepting knees or short counter-hooks, leading to highlight-reel knockouts.
However, his hyper-aggressive striking style produces high-variance outcomes. Fights involving Njokuani rarely feature passive lulls, making his Octagon appearances high-stakes encounters from the opening bell to the final horn.
Strategic Betting Angles and Path to Victory
Betting markets consistently evaluate Njokuani as a high-risk, high-reward dynamic striker. Formulating a sound prediction requires balancing his game-changing offensive power against his vulnerabilities when brought to the canvas.
- Early Stoppage Prop Value: The most consistent wagering angle for a Njokuani bout centers on round totals. His rapid pacing and pursuit of the finish yield extremely high early stoppage percentages.
- Range Control and Clinch Warfare: Pure strikers often struggle against Njokuani. His ability to frame off attacks and land heavy body knees in the clinch turns pocket exchanges into high-danger zones for opponents.
- Grappling Defense and Control Time: The key blueprint to defeating Njokuani lies in relentless top control. Opponents capable of surviving his initial blitz can accumulate ground control time if they land proactive takedowns.
- Weight Class Dynamics: Njokuani’s speed and leverage fluctuate based on his division. His physical power is most potent when maintaining a quickness advantage over bulkier opponents.
By assessing these stylistic matchups rather than simple win-loss streaks, handicappers can better project his fight outcomes against specific styles.
